  1. land攻击

    攻击者发送SYN报文的源地址和目标地址同为被攻击者的IP地址,导致被攻击者向其自己的地址发送SYN-ACK消息,使被攻击者主机存在大量空连接。不同被攻击者对Land攻击反应不同,UNIX主机将崩溃,Windows NT主机的运行状态会变的极其缓慢。

    -S:设置SYN flag标志位为1,即发送SYN报文;
    
    -p 445:被攻击的目标端口 TCP 445;
    
    192.168.200.107:被攻击的目标地址;
    
    -a 192.168.200.107:被攻击者的IP源地址;
    
    -c 10:仅发送攻击报文10个;
    
    --fast: alias for -i u10000 (10 packets for second);
    
    --faster:alias for -i u1000 (100 packets for second);
    -d 500 设置TCP playload为500字节
    --flood:sent packets as fast as possible. Don't show replies;

4. snort rules

  • 规则/etc/snort/rules/local.rules

     alert tcp any any -> any any (msg:"Possible DDOS attack"; flags:S; threshold: type both, track by_src, count 1, seconds 1; sid:100001; rev:1;)
     alert tcp any any -> $HOME_NET any (flags: S; msg:"Possible DoS Attack Type : SYNflood"; flow:stateless; sid:100002; detection_filter:track by_dst, count 10, seconds 3;)
     #TearDrop 攻击
     alert ip any any -> any any (fragoffset:0; fragbits:M; id:2465; msg:"Possible Teardrop attack detected"; sid:100003;)
     alert udp any any -> any any (msg:"Possible TearDrop attack detected!"; dsize: < 64; sid:100004;)
     #ICMP Flood 攻击
     alert icmp any any -> any any (msg:"Possible ICMP Flood attack detected"; threshold: type both, track by_src, count 1, seconds 1; sid:100005; rev:1;)
     alert icmp any any -> $HOME_NET any (msg:"ICMP flood"; sid:100006; rev:1; classtype:icmp-event; detection_filter:track by_dst, count 10, seconds 3;)
     #UDP Flood 攻击
     alert udp any any -> any any (msg:"Possible UDP Flood attack"; threshold: type both, track by_src, count 1, seconds 1; sid:100007; rev:1;)
     #SYN Flood 攻击
     alert tcp any any -> any any (msg:"Possible SYN Flood attack"; flags:S; threshold: type both, track by_src, count 1, seconds 1; sid:100008; rev:1;)
     alert tcp any any -> any any (flags: S; threshold: type both, track by_src, count 100, seconds 10; msg:"Possible SYN Flood Attack"; sid:100009; rev:1;)
